Hello,

this is an ancient creature made by the ancestors of the piglin tribes to oversee and maintain the vast warped and crimson forests in the Nether.


How the mechanical elephant got in the Nether

Piglins originated from a tribe of people who once lived on the Earth's surface but were banished into the Nether for opening a portal to the Nether. (I know this sounds stupid but it'll make sense in the end).
They were excellent craftsmen and had an extensive technological understanding. For a tribe, they were far developed. One day, they figured out how to open a portal to another dimension. In this newly discovered world, they found materials that didn't exist on Earth and therefore had a high value. Trade in and out of the portal flourished. To keep the new civilisation in a good shape, they designed a machine that would take care of the Nether forests, as they were the only source of highly demanded warped and crimson wood (people on Earth adored it for its otherworldly color) and to keep the forests at bay which had the tendency to grow all over the place.
When designing the machine, they took inspiration from tribes on Earth using elephants to move logs around. They made their machine the shape of an elephant and gave it a trunk which allowed it to move trees if they were growing in the wrong place, equipped it with four eyes for better all-round vision, gave it four tusks with machine guns in two of them to defend itself, hung many lanterns on it so that they could find it more easily in the dark Nether and hard-coded in its mechanical brain to always keep the forests in a healthy condition.
This way, the pioneers in the Nether could expand without their settlements being overgrown, even during long absence (there were many expeditions to explore the Nether which often required settlements to be abandoned for a while). Also, with the elephant maintaining the forests, there would always be enough warped and crimson wood to export.
For the elephant to be autonomous, they implemented a heat exchange system that powered the elephant using thermal energy. This thermal energy was provided when the elephant drank lava of which there was plenty in the Nether (so basically a stirling engine powered by hot lava).
To withstand rock falls and to keep the mechanism safe from the spiky surface, they fully armored the elephant's back and belly. The trunk also was armored because it would be the most endangered part in terms of scratches by rocks or trees. The head was completely armored, too, obviously because it contained the mechanical brain.
So far, life was good: the elephant took care of the forests and thus helped the pioneers explore and colonize the Nether while guaranteeing a steady supply of warped and crimson wood to the Overworld.

But, you know, fear changes peoples' minds...
The portal to the Nether created strange noises and once in a while creatures from the Nether would escape to the overworld. Soon, environmental disasters appeared strangely often and in their dispair and lack of knowledge the people from the Overworld blamed it on the portal. And to most people it made sense. Didn't they have a much more peaceful life before the portal to an infernal dimension was opened? When there were no scary noises, no scary creatures exiting the portal and no massed environmental disasters? Yes, they were sure if they destroyed the portal, everything would go back to normal. But that was not enough. To ensure there would never be such horrible events again, they wanted to wipe the portal and everyone who knew how to create one from existence.
In a stormy night, the scholars and scientists and everyone who had worked on opening the portal was banished into the nether by their own people. Since they were too few to fight back physically, they tried to explain the environmental disasters had nothing to do with the portal but their words were carried away by the storm's rumble. No one listened. The portal broke down the same night.
Without the supply from the overworld, the people in the Nether started eating what they could find: fungi with funny or poisenous effects, their allies, even parts of warped and crimson trees. Over time, they developed into what would later be known as the "zombie piglin" (they didn't get enough water either). Civilization in the Overworld collapsed like every other society after some time, no matter how developed it was.
The elephant however, self-sustaining as it had been built, continued to tend the Nether forests indefinitely – as if nothing had happened.
